Behavior3/5

Does the description disclose side effects, auth requirements, rate limits, or destructive behavior?

With no annotations, the description carries the full burden. It states that 'delete' translates to 'unsubscribe and archive', which is useful behavioral context. However, it does not disclose potential side effects (e.g., triggering automation, sending notifications), permissions required, or error conditions (e.g., member not found). The description is not misleading but is incomplete for full transparency.

Agents need to know what a tool does to the world before calling it. Descriptions should go beyond structured annotations to explain consequences.

Purpose5/5

Does the description clearly state what the tool does and how it differs from similar tools?

The description uses a specific verb 'Delete' and clarifies the operation as 'unsubscribe and archive', which precisely distinguishes it from sibling tools like mailchimp_members_archive (which only archives) and mailchimp_members_update (which updates). It clearly identifies the resource as 'a member from a list'.

Agents choose between tools based on descriptions. A clear purpose with a specific verb and resource helps agents select the right tool.
